Abstract
Ethyl 2-ethoxycarbonyl-3,5-dioxoiiexanoate (1-b) was synthesized by the hydrogenolysis and hydrolysis of diethyl (3-methyl-5-isoxazolyl)malonate (3-b), which was obtained by the di-carboxylation of 3,5-dimethylisoxazole (4) with ethyl cyanoformate in the presence of butyllithium.
